OKX and HashKey invest in new Vietnam exchange ahead of crypto licensing push

Why This Matters

OKX and HashKey's investment in a new Vietnam exchange aims to meet the country's $380 million capital requirement for a government pilot program, potentially paving the way for licensed crypto platforms in Vietnam. This development could increase investor confidence in the region's crypto market. The partnership may also curb offshore trading by providing a regulated alternative.
